Jane Street Group LLC lessened its position in shares of Grocery Outlet Holding Corp. (NASDAQ:GO - Free Report) by 39.1%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The fund owned 316,551 shares of the company's stock after selling 202,991 shares during the quarter. Jane Street Group LLC owned 0.33% of Grocery Outlet worth $4,941,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Grocery Outlet (NASDAQ:GO -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, May 6th. The company reported $0.13 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$0.07 by $0.06. Grocery Outlet had a return on equity of 5.25% and a net margin of 1.20%. The firm had revenue of $1.13 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.12 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$0.09 earnings per share. The company's revenue for the quarter was up 8.6% compared to the same quarter last year. Grocery Outlet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Grocery Outlet Holding Corp. operates as a retailer of consumables and fresh products sold through independently operated stores in the United States. Its stores offer products in various categories, such as dairy and deli, produce, floral, fresh meat, seafood products, grocery, general merchandise, health and beauty care, frozen food, beer and wine, and ethnic products.
